Pete Van Nostrand

Pete Van Nostrand was born and raised in Binghamton, NY. A graduate of Rutgers University, and The Juilliard School, he has been around New York since 2000 and has been called on to perform with Steve Davis, Jeremy Pelt, Eric Reed, Aaron Parks, Gerald Clayton, Dan Nimmer, Jeb Patton, Jim Rotundi, Mike LeDonne, Paula West, Sachal Vasandani, Kenny Barron, Brian Lynch, Jimmy Heath, Kurt Elling, The Clayton Brothers, and Natalie Cole. In recent years he has toured extensively with the Jeb Patton trio, Aaron Diehl Quartet, Cécile McLorin Salvant, and the Gerald Clayton trio. A supportive sideman and young veteran of the New York City Jazz scene, he continues to keep busy in New York and on the road.
